Forumsvortrag «Spectrum of Desire: Love, Sex, & Gender in the Middle Ages» mit Melanie Holcomb & Nancy Thebaut
Currently on view at The Met Cloisters (NY), the exhibition Spectrum of Desire considers how medieval objects reveal and structure the performance of gender, understandings of the body, and erotic encounters, both physical and spiritual. It offers new readings of often familiar objects in which gender, sexuality, relationships, and bodies are central themes, and its methods draw from gender studies and queer theory to help museum visitors question past assumptions and read against the grain of modern heteronormativity. In this joint presentation, the exhibition’s co-curators, Melanie Holcomb & Nancy Thebaut, will offer an in-depth look at the exhibition and share new insights on objects that proved particularly challenging in their research.
